Astellas Uses Boltz for Protein Target Research
HannesStaerk · x · 2026-07-16
Astellas has publicly shared how they used Boltz to research a membrane protein target: the team identified validated molecules that performed comparably to clinical candidates in in vitro experiments.
The highlight of this case is efficiency: the number of required experiments reportedly dropped by 90%, and the overall timeline was shortened by 70%. This serves as a clear AI for Science use case.
